sdg1871, yes, I am keen on getting the F10 with the M-Sport suspension but am having second thoughts in view of the fact that initial test reports in the UK of the F10 with the standard suspension on 18" wheels have found the ride to be somewhat harsh and "crashy" over badly surfaced roads. Oddly, despite that, some have found the standard suspension to be somewhat soft (and floaty) with noticeable body roll. Not sure if the M-Sport suspension with 17" wheels would be the optimum compromise between handling and ride comfort.

(a) how comfortable is it when compared to the F10/adaptive suspension/"Sport" mode - is it less or more comfortable?
>>>> I asked this from Munich - they told that it's between normal and sport mode. The biggest difference is that it's missing the active anti roll system
(b) would you say that it is between the "Sport" and "Normal" mode of the F10/adaptive suspension in terms of comfort, that is, harder than the "Normal" mode but softer than the "Sport" mode?
>>>> I asked this from Munich - they told that it's between normal and sport mode. The biggest difference is that it's missing the active anti roll system
(b) would you say that it is between the "Sport" and "Normal" mode of the F10/adaptive suspension in terms of comfort, that is, harder than the "Normal" mode but softer than the "Sport" mode?
Hi TGll, when you mentioned that the M Sport suspension is between normal and sport mode, are you referring to between normal and sport mode of a f10 with variable damping control/VDC/dynamic damping control?
And when you say that the difference is the missing active anti-roll system, meaning the M sport suspension does not have the active anti-roll bars as one cannot have M sport suspension with the active anti-roll system (and also VDC) as they are not compatible?

Many of you requested pictures - here come the first ones. I detailed the car today with Swissvax Cleaner Fluid and Swissvax Concorso Premium Wax.
The paintwork finishing is much better than in my previous E60. The new type of anthrasite headliner is not exactly my thing - it is semi glossy and I liked the previous type used in E60 more. May be I get used to it though.
My first impression is that the car is much more comfortable also with the M-Sport suspension than the E60 - and still dynamic and sporty - I really like the way it drives.
All electronic devices are far better and nicer than the E60 had, they have really done a good job with the usability of all features.
